GENERAL SUMNER TO GOVERNOR NASH.

Camp Chatham Court House, Sept. 5th, 1780.

Sir:

I make use of the opportunity of this express to inform your Excellency of our coming thus far; I have given orders for marching off early in the morning, and we will proceed with all speed to Salisbury.

I am, with the highest Esteem and Sir,
Your Excellency's most Obedient Servant,
JETHRO SUMNER.
His Excellency Abner Nash.
